I wanted to share my Tolstoi collection with the board and get some thoughts. Seems that I have 212 of the 254 confirmed examples
https://imageevent.com/vanslykefan/s...0&m=24&w=0&p=0 When I started this journey about a decade ago, Tolstoi's weren't that difficult to find. It seems they have dried up and I am more or less seeing the same examples over and over. Cobb's are out there, but a bit pricey... Is anyone else going after this back? Would like to hear on your experience collecting this set. http://t206resource.com/Tolstoi%20Checklist.html These are the 42 confirmed examples that I am missing - a couple have come up the last year or so, but have been out of my price range. Fantastic collection, Rob. I love the Tolstois! Most of the examples that I have seen have a faint Tolstoi "wet sheet transfer" overprint on the front. Most of yours don't seem to have that, which is a tribute to you.

That's what I don't like about Tolstoi. A big part of the attraction of T206 for me is the beautiful colors on the front. WST ruins the image. I rarely even search for Tolstoi because so many of them have that faint Tolstoi image on the front. Maybe it's my perception, but it seems to be even more prevalent on better condition cards.
